Santa Fe Milkvetch - Astragalus feensis
601607
Species Extent (New Mexico)
General Description
Perennial; stems short, prostrate, 1-6 cm long; herbage densely villous or villosulous with basifixed hairs; leaves 4-9 cm long; leaflets (7)9-15, often folded, 3-12 mm long, 2-3 times longer than wide; stipules free; inflorescences taller than or included in the foliage, with 7-12, densely or loosely disposed ascending-spreading pea-like flowers; calyx tubes tubular, 4.5-6.5 mm long, calyx lobes 1-2 mm; corolla 12-16 mm long, pale pink-purple; fruits divaricate-humistrate, sessile, bilocular or nearly so, deciduous, dehiscent, body curved to 180, triquetrous (3-sided), short-beaked, (1)2-3 cm long, 4-5 mm wide, dorsally sulcate (furrowed on side away from stem), valves leathery, reticulate, strigulose. Flowers April through June.
